The TWD/XRP (XRP) pair represents the exchange rate between the New Taiwan Dollar and the digital asset XRP. This pairing is significant for Taiwanese investors seeking exposure to a cryptocurrency focused on revolutionizing cross-border payments. XRP (XRP) operates on the XRP Ledger (XRPL), a distinct blockchain technology that uses a unique consensus protocol to validate transactions in seconds at a very low cost. Unlike many other digital assets, XRP was not designed for mining; all 100 billion tokens were pre-mined at its inception. Its primary utility is to act as an intermediary or 'bridge' currency, eliminating the need for pre-funded nostro accounts in international transactions, which is a key component of Ripple's On-Demand Liquidity (ODL) solution. For traders in Taiwan, monitoring the TWD/XRP (XRP) chart is essential for identifying market trends, analyzing volatility, and making strategic decisions to buy or sell. Understanding the tokenomics of XRP and the ongoing developments within the Ripple ecosystem is crucial for assessing its long-term value proposition as a digital payment protocol.

To buy XRP (XRP) with TWD, you need to find a cryptocurrency exchange that supports TWD deposits or a TWD/XRP trading pair. First, create and verify an account on a compliant exchange. Next, deposit TWD using a supported method like a bank transfer. Finally, navigate to the trading section, select the XRP/TWD pair, and execute a buy order for your desired amount.

The primary purpose of XRP (XRP) is to serve as a bridge currency for fast and efficient cross-border payments. It is the native asset of the XRP Ledger (XRPL) and is utilized by Ripple's On-Demand Liquidity (ODL) service to settle international transactions in real-time, reducing costs and delays associated with traditional banking systems.

The security of your XRP (XRP) holdings depends on your storage methods. While the XRP Ledger itself is built with robust cryptographic security, your assets are vulnerable if held on an insecure exchange. For enhanced security, use reputable platforms with two-factor authentication (2FA) and consider transferring your XRP (XRP) to a personal hardware wallet for long-term storage.

The XRP Ledger (XRPL) uses a unique consensus protocol, not Proof-of-Work or Proof-of-Stake. A set of independent validator nodes must agree on the order and outcome of transactions. This federated consensus model allows for extremely fast transaction confirmation (3-5 seconds) and low costs, as it doesn't involve competitive mining.

To sell XRP (XRP) for New Taiwan Dollars, you would transfer your XRP (XRP) from your wallet to an exchange that offers a XRP/TWD pair. On the exchange, place a sell order. Once the order is executed, the TWD funds will be available in your exchange account for withdrawal to your linked Taiwanese bank account.

Ripple is a private technology company that provides payment solutions to financial institutions. XRP (XRP) is the independent, open-source digital asset that powers the decentralized XRP Ledger. While Ripple leverages XRP (XRP) in its products like On-Demand Liquidity, the XRP Ledger and the XRP asset exist and operate independently of the company.

In Taiwan, the Financial Supervisory Commission (FSC) requires virtual asset service providers (VASPs), including exchanges, to comply with Anti-Money Laundering (AML) and Counter-Terrorism Financing (CTF) regulations. This means you will need to complete identity verification (KYC) to buy or sell XRP (XRP) on a compliant Taiwanese exchange.

While XRP (XRP) transactions are very fast and cheap, its primary design is for inter-bank and cross-border settlements, not everyday retail purchases. Its adoption as a direct payment method in stores is not widespread. However, its use in peer-to-peer transactions is growing through various wallet applications.
